#7d6b01 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7d6b01 is composed of 49% red, 42%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.4% magenta, 99.2%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 51.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 24.7%. #7d6b01 color hex could be obtained by blending #fad602 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

● #7d6b01 color description : Dark yellow [Olive tone].
#7d6b01 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7d6b01 has RGB values of R:125, G:107,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.14, Y:0.99,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8219393.

Shades and Tints of #7d6b01
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080700 is the darkest color, while #fffdf4 is the lightest one.
